#e430f2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e430f2 is composed of 89.4% red, 18.8%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.8% cyan, 80.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 295.7 degrees, a saturation of 88.2% and a lightness of 56.9%. #e430f2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ff60ff with #c900e5. Closest websafe color is: #cc33ff.

Shades and Tints of #e430f2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d010e is the darkest color, while #fefbff is the lightest one.
